Blog post #3: Online Dating: Does it really work?

Many people decide to try online dating for the mere fact that there is a limitless amount of choice in terms of potential matches. This is based on algorithms and different categories that one would  be looking for. If we look at the dating website Eharmony who gathered statistics from Statistics Canada reports that in 2014, there were 14.2 million single Canadians using online dating. In this day and age, online dating seems like the way for me people. According to Eharmony, there are 36% of Canadians who use online dating, 52.4% being men while 47.6% being women. If we look an article by Global news, they report that according to a 2011 Leger Marketing survey, 36% of Canadians between the ages of 19 to 34 used online dating. So this begs the question, does online dating really work to meet potential single people?

According to an article from 2013 called “Meeting online leads to happier, more enduring marriages,” and based on research from the University of Chicago, they report that over a third of marriages between 2005 and 2012 began online and have resulted in longer and more successful marriages. This article suggests that the reason for this is because of the availability and limitless amount of people to choose from online, as well as the screening process which are based on questionnaires (if answered honestly). Everyone is of course different, and whether or not someone decides to use online dating forums is based on preference.

As seen above, it is clear that more and more, people of all ages, but especially young people are leaning more towards online dating because it is convenience and offers a great choice of suitors, this makes it attractive since you literally have people at your fingertips.
